Sensex advances by 103 points; highest level since 2008
Mumbai, Aug.4 (ANI): The Bombay Stock Exchange benchmark Sensex on Wednesday advanced by 103 points to its highest level since February 5, 2008, led by IT majors Tata Consultancy Services and Infosys Technologies.
The Bombay Stock Exchange's 30-share index rose further by 102.61 points, or 0.57 per cent, to 18,217.44 on Wednesday. It had gained nearly 247 points in the previous two trading sessions.
In tandem, the broad-based National Stock Exchange index Nifty rose by 28.30 points, or 0.52 per cent, to 5,467.85, after touching an intra-day high of 5,481.90.
Today, in early trade, the rupee lost 12 paise against the US dollar due to demand for the US currency from importers.
An estimated 50 per cent of Indian software companies' revenue comes from US and European markets. (ANI)
